Originally Posted by Bimmer32' post='553446' date='Mar 31 2008, 12:20 AM
That's a load question since Remus and RD Sport makes the quad, but you have to do some custom mandrel bent per VT (he had RD on his m5 rear bumper). Remus appears to have a good fit for your m5 rear, but some people don't like the the "unbalanced" sound because Remus uses one muffler as you already know. Remus owner, please chime in.
Sound is so relative, you almost have to state your preference to get some sort of answer from people who "been there done that." In any case, your biggest challenge is the narrow space on the right side for muffler fitment. You can put a couple of mufflers upstream, but it will hang pass your vehicle's current ground clearance maybe by 1/2 to 1 in" using 4-4.5 inches thick mufflers.
